What happened: PMAY-G review and state-wise implementation snapshot (June 2026)
The Ministry of Rural Development reports that Pradhan Mantri Awaas Yojana–Gramin (PMAY-G) is reviewed through multiple mechanisms: Performance Review Committee (PRC) meetings, Empowered Committee (EC) meetings, Common Review Mission (CRM), Area Officers Schemes, reports of national level monitors, and regular field visits by ministry officers. Empowered Committee (EC) meetings were held in March 2026. Annexure I provides state-wise numbers of houses sanctioned, completed, and pending as of June 2026.
Background and earlier position: scheme structure and delivery support logic
PMAY-G is a centrally supported rural housing initiative implemented through states. In the scheme design described in the government’s Rajya Sabha written reply, housing delivery is supported not only through housing unit assistance but also through convergence for sanitation (toilet construction through Swachh Bharat Mission–Gramin) and livelihood support (unskilled wage employment through convergence with MGNREGS/VB G-RAM G, within approved scheme parameters and at prevailing wage rates).
What changed now: EC/PRC/CRM and the June 2026 sanctioned–completed–pending status
The current update focuses on (i) the timing of Empowered Committee (EC) meetings in March 2026, and (ii) the state-wise quantified implementation status as of June 2026—covering houses sanctioned, houses completed, and houses pending across all listed states and Union Territories.
